Muscles and Fascia of the Trunk — Abdominal Muscles
The abdomen is the part of the trunk located between the Thorax above and the pelvis below. Its cavity is the Abdominal cavity, the walls of which are formed above by the Diaphragm, below by the pelvic bones and Muscles as well as the pelvic floor (Perineum). The posterior wall of the abdominal cavity is formed by THE Vertebral Column and the paired quadratus lumborum Muscle. The anterior and lateral walls of the abdominal cavity are likewise formed by the paired external and internal oblique, transversus abdominis, and rectus abdominis muscles.
The external oblique muscle of the abdomen is broad and thin, originating by digitations from the eight lower Ribs. The muscle then runs downward and forward, continuing into a broad tendon (aponeurosis) that attaches to the iliac crest and the Pubic Symphysis. In the region between the anterior part of the ilium and the pubic tubercle, the aponeurosis of the external oblique folds inward and thickens, forming the inguinal ligament. Along the midline of the anterior abdominal wall, the aponeurosis of the external oblique joins the corresponding tendon of the opposite side, forming the linea alba (white line of the abdomen). This line extends from the xiphoid process above to the pubic symphysis below.
Approximately at the midpoint of the linea alba lies the umbilical ring (navel), which is closed by Connective Tissue. In embryos and fetuses, Blood Vessels (umbilical vessels) pass through the umbilical ring. The umbilical ring can also be a site for The formation of umbilical hernias.
The internal oblique muscle of the abdomen lies beneath the external oblique. It originates from the thoracolumbar fascia, the iliac crest, and the inguinal ligament, and runs upward and forward. This muscle inserts into the cartilages of the lower ribs, and its broad aponeurosis contributes to the Formation of the linea alba. The transversus abdominis muscle lies in the third layer, beneath the two preceding oblique muscles. It originates from the inner surface of the six lower ribs, the thoracolumbar fascia, the iliac crest, and the inguinal ligament. The broad aponeurosis of this muscle blends into the linea alba. The rectus abdominis muscle is situated laterally to the linea alba. It originates from the xiphoid process of the Sternum and the cartilages of ribs V–VII. The muscle bundles run vertically downward and attach to the pubic crest and the pubic symphysis. Both the right and left rectus abdominis muscles are enclosed within their own strong tendinous sheath (rectus sheath), formed by the aponeuroses of the external and internal oblique and transversus abdominis muscles. The rectus abdominis muscles pull the rib cage downward and flex the trunk. The oblique muscles also bend the trunk forward, assist in its rotation to the right and left, and aid in Respiration due to their attachments to the ribs.
The quadratus lumborum muscle is located laterally to the lumbar spine. It originates from the 12th rib and the transverse processes of lumbar vertebrae I–IV. The muscle inserts into the iliac crest and the transverse processes of the lower lumbar vertebrae. Upon contraction, this muscle bends the spine to its side.
Upon contraction, the Abdominal muscles increase intra-abdominal pressure, which is essential for maintaining Internal Organs in their natural positions. Intra-abdominal pressure facilitates bowel evacuation (defecation), urination, and, in women, the expulsion of the fetus from the Uterus during childbirth. Due to these Functions, the abdominal muscles form what is known as the abdominal press.
Externally, beneath the subcutaneous tissue, the abdominal muscles are covered by the superficial fascia, which is a continuation of the superficial Fascia of the chest. On the abdominal cavity side, the abdominal walls are lined by the transversalis fascia (endoabdominal fascia).
Due to their complex Structure, weak spots exist in the abdominal walls where hernias may develop. These include the linea alba, the umbilical ring, and the Inguinal Canal. The slit-like inguinal canal is located above the inguinal ligament, between the aponeurosis of the external oblique muscle anteriorly and the transversalis fascia posteriorly. The upper wall of the inguinal canal is formed by the lower margins of the internal oblique and transversus abdominis muscles. The superficial (external) ring of the inguinal canal lies above the medial part of the inguinal ligament. Through the inguinal canal pass the Spermatic Cord in men and the round ligament of the uterus in women.
